Hey — handing over the Soundloom waveform preview service. Plugin authors hit it for peak data; rendering is cached per track. The only gotcha is the downsample ratio, which plugins must not override. Everything else is tweakable. Before you publish the plugin docs, note the current service configuration values below.

service settings:
[istox]
host = istox.qorvelforge.internal
user = istox_svc
database = istox_prod

**Release Checklist — SweepWright Retention Pass**

Before closing the release, confirm the SweepWright retention sweeper completed its dry run against the archive tier and flagged nothing newer than 90 days. Support should expect a brief dip in search results while indexes rebuild. Verification requires matching the sweep report against the build token shown below.

build token for kagaf-hahof: htk14_9d3d4d26d7d8de

## Tuning

Squishpress is a CLI for batch image resizing, and most of its speed comes from getting the worker pool and chunk size right for your disk. The defaults assume a laptop SSD and modest RAM; reviewers on the Bramble CI runners may want smaller chunks. The knobs and their current defaults are below.

tuning constants:
QUOTAS = {
    "druwyn": 5,
    "holix": 5,
    "zorath": 5,
    "holwyn": 10,
}